The best part is, If you place the level 1 altar on the top of the hill, mine down to the bottom of your altars build height, you can place down another just above the shroud and remove the first altar. That you can see the upper limit of the new altars build area poking barely through the ground, which means the tunnels you dug never reset as long as your Flame altar is still there. and you can reach well down into the shroud with your build limit. But you can still be away enough so that the salt mine itself can reset. And when you get further into the game and don't need to worry about salt anymore you can do the same thing in pretty much any hill above shroud if you happen to find a good spot for mining or farming any Shroud material you might need.
Right now salt is the only one that was a bit of a headache mostly because you need it so early but it might be a nice thing to remember when new areas and resources open up after the full game is released as I imagine we can't always just rely on our shroud timer getting longer and longer when we get to even higher level areas

Even without the rake, I think a lot of the terrain types give more back than the 1 it costs to put down. I found this out when trying to light an underground area with the blue glowy stuff with the terrain type (not the crafted block type) and I was getting more back than I had used to place down the chunk. But the rake method is definitely faster and more guaranteed.
